The gap in Australian healthcare

“Everything looks fine” isn't a health plan

Standard pathology flags disease — not how you feel day to day. You can sit inside normal ranges while ferritin, vitamin D, or thyroid markers explain fatigue, weight, or flat recovery.

Omri Health compares your markers to optimal ranges, gives food-first actions with evidence ratings, and flags what deserves a conversation with your GP.

I sleep eight hours and still feel wrecked

Fatigue often hides in ferritin, thyroid, vitamin D, and B12 — markers GPs rarely walk through in detail.

A clear read on what's draining you, and food-first steps to address it.

My GP said everything looks fine

Standard ranges flag disease, not optimisation. You can be "normal" and still far from where healthy people sit.

Optimal-range context for every marker, plus flags worth raising with your doctor.

I want to age well — not just avoid illness

Biological age, inflammation, and metabolic markers reveal whether you're ageing faster or slower than your years.

A longitudinal picture and a plan built around what your blood is actually saying.

I need supplements that fit Halal / Vegan / GF

Mainstream AU brands rarely certify Halal. Most apps ignore gelatine capsules, fish oil, and lanolin D3 — leaving 3M+ Australians guessing.

Every recommendation filtered for your faith and diet, with clear compliance badges.

I'm training hard but recovery feels off

Testosterone, iron, cortisol, and glucose markers often explain plateaus that diet tweaks alone won't fix.

Targeted actions with evidence ratings — no supplement stack guesswork.
